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

वर्चर से फ्लोट में MySQL डेटाटाइप रूपांतरण

आप फ्लोट प्रकार का उपयोग करके mysql में मान नहीं डाल सकते।

प्रकार निम्नलिखित मानों का उपयोग कर सकता है:

  • बाइनरी[(एन)]
  • चार[(एन)]
  • तारीख
  • DATETIME
  • दशमलव[(एम[,डी])]
  • हस्ताक्षरित [INTEGER]
  • समय
  • अहस्ताक्षरित [पूर्णांक]

तो आपके मामले में आपको दशमलव का उपयोग करना होगा, जैसे:

select cast(amount AS DECIMAL(10,2)) as 'float-value' from amounts


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. mysql . के साथ उल्का

  2. MySQL बैकस्लैश नहीं डाल रहा है

  3. क्या मुझे टेबल कॉलम में कोई डेटा नहीं दर्शाने के लिए NULL या खाली स्ट्रिंग का उपयोग करना चाहिए?

  4. MySQL में डिलीट के बाद ऑटो इंक्रीमेंट

  5. INT . की तुलना में BIGINT mysql प्रदर्शन